Types of Racing Go-Kart Seats

Go-kart seats come in various forms, each designed for different needs and preferences. The most common types include bucket seats and molded seats.

  • Bucket Seats: These seats are renowned for their exceptional lateral support. Their sculpted design effectively cradles the driver’s body, minimizing movement during high-speed maneuvers. This focused support translates to improved control and responsiveness.
  • Molded Seats: Molded seats typically feature a high-density foam core, often reinforced with composite materials. They provide good overall body support, though the level of lateral support might be slightly less pronounced than in bucket seats. The adjustability of recline is usually a key feature, enabling optimal driver positioning.

Materials Used in Racing Go-Kart Seats

The choice of materials directly impacts the seat’s performance, durability, and comfort. A range of materials is employed, each offering distinct benefits.

  • Carbon Fiber: Known for its exceptional strength-to-weight ratio, carbon fiber is increasingly used in high-performance go-kart seats. This material contributes to a lightweight yet robust seat, enhancing the kart’s overall performance.
  • Reinforced Plastic: Reinforced plastics are commonly used due to their durability and affordability. They offer a reliable structural base for the seat, balancing cost-effectiveness with adequate performance.
  • High-Density Foam: A crucial component of many go-kart seats, high-density foam provides the primary cushioning and support for the driver. The density of the foam directly impacts the seat’s comfort and durability.

Manufacturing Processes, Racing go kart seat

The production of go-kart seats encompasses a variety of methods, each with its own strengths and weaknesses. These processes often involve a blend of automated techniques and skilled craftsmanship. The choice of method is heavily influenced by the desired level of customization, production volume, and cost considerations.

  • Injection Molding: A widely used technique, injection molding allows for the creation of complex shapes from melted plastic materials. This method is highly efficient for large-scale production and offers a good balance of cost-effectiveness and precision. The use of molds ensures consistent seat shapes and dimensions.
  • Hand-Crafting: For high-end, customized go-kart seats, hand-crafting offers a unique advantage. Skilled artisans can meticulously assemble components and fine-tune every detail, resulting in a seat tailored to specific needs and preferences. This approach is particularly suitable for limited-production runs or custom designs.
  • Laser Cutting: Precise laser cutting is frequently used for fabricating seat components like supports or decorative pieces. The precision of the laser cutting method allows for intricate designs, often resulting in lighter components without compromising strength.

Cleaning and Upkeep for Different Materials

Different materials require specific cleaning methods to prevent damage. A careless approach can quickly diminish the quality of your seat, while the correct approach extends its life and keeps it looking great.

  • Leather: Use a damp cloth and a specialized leather cleaner for cleaning. Avoid harsh chemicals or abrasive materials. Regular conditioning with a leather conditioner will maintain its suppleness and appearance.
  • Synthetic Materials: Mild soap and water are usually sufficient for cleaning. Ensure the soap is non-abrasive to avoid scratching the material. Thoroughly dry the seat after cleaning to prevent water damage.
  • Fabric: Check the manufacturer’s instructions for specific cleaning guidelines. Spot clean any spills promptly. Avoid excessive moisture or harsh detergents. Consider using a fabric protector to safeguard the material.

Importance of Regular Inspection for Wear and Tear

Regular inspections are essential for identifying potential issues before they escalate. This proactive approach is more cost-effective than dealing with major repairs later. By checking for wear and tear, you can avoid costly replacements and keep your go-kart seat functioning at its peak.

  • Inspect for tears, rips, or excessive wear on the stitching and material. This will help you catch damage early.
  • Check for loose or damaged fasteners. Make sure everything is securely fastened and functioning correctly.
  • Examine the padding for unevenness or signs of compression. Adjustments might be needed if you notice any inconsistencies.
